Christine's research interests are in human genetics and epidemiology. Her work combines whole genome analysis to identify genetic and epigenetic changes in cardiovascular and autoimmune diseases, with demographic and clinical information from large disease cohorts to understand health and lifestyle factors that are associated with these conditions.
